Museum Heist Crash Bug

Some items didn't have their "trade data" defined properly, and would cause a game crash if you tried to steal them from the museum. I think the only items with this problem were the dice, and the hints. Both are fixed now and you should be able to steal whatever you want from the museum.

Item Pickup Bug

There was a bug where if an NPC perfectly overlaps an item, it might become impossible to pick up the item. This rarely happens, but is potentially pretty bad!

I fixed it by giving items priority over NPCs. If you are touching an item you will always have the prompt to pick up the item, even if you are also touching an NPC.

This made me worry about some kind of scenario where you can no longer interact with an NPC because they're covered with items. I don't think this can actually happen, because you can just put the items in your bag, or throw them out of the way if they're too large. However, just in case, I added a secret failsafe:

If you hold the "Open/Close Bag" button for over one second, you'll ignore items and only get prompts for NPC interaction. So you can interact with a buried NPC by opening your bag with the button, then pressing and holding the button.

This is obviously not intuitive, and it's not explained anywhere in the game. It's just there so I can tell people about it if they get stuck (which hopefully won't be possible).
